What You Do Today
Oversee the network that supports classroom technology — WiFi coverage, bandwidth allocation, content filtering, and the infrastructure that makes digital learning possible.
AI That Applies
AI monitors network performance in real-time, predicts bandwidth bottlenecks, auto-adjusts content filtering rules, and identifies devices causing network issues.

What Changes
Network management becomes proactive. AI identifies and resolves connectivity issues before teachers notice them.
What Stays
Planning network infrastructure upgrades, managing content filtering policies that balance safety with educational access, and working within tight budgets — that's your strategic role.
